OutRun Online Arcade has been removed from the Xbox Live Arcade shop, you can still download a trial but what’s the point in that? It’s gone forever, or until some sort of licensing miracle is put in place again. All that’s left to do is to pick over the precious carcass of memories and attempt to get through the rest of January without self-harming.

“Do you remember you wanted us to stop at the beach for some sunbathing and you left the beach towels on the side in the hotel didn’t you? Then what happened? I had to drive all the way back into town to get them and all the way back to the beach and when we got there it was packed full of screaming children and fat lumpy women.”

“How about the time you ordered me pull over to ask for directions when I told you I knew where we were going? I knew where we were going because the most difficult navigational decision I needed to make was whether to go left or right at the pre-designated branching points. But you wouldn’t listen to me.”

“You remember this place don’t you? We stopped for lunch on a Sunday and had that conversation about you wanting to have a baby. Not about wanting a baby specifically with me but that you “want a baby and if you don’t want one then you’ll have to decide what you want out of this relationship”. That was a fun day out.”

“What about the time you kept moaning on at me because I didn’t have a blanket in the car for the mountain drive and that, actually, owning a sports car was incredibly vain and “obvious.” Well it didn’t seem to be a problem when you were telling all your awful braying friends the type of car I owned. In fact, you went out of your way to make sure they all knew it was a “red one that goes fast and has an open top.”

“You wanted to stop here because it was a “statue” and you wanted to see it because apparently I never take to you see anything cultural. Then I found out your best friend had been there a year earlier and the only reason you wanted to see it was so you could say you’d been there too. You can’t even remember what the place was called can you other than it had a “nice little Sushi restaurant”? Go on, try and remember what the place was called.”
